WebThe min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) ranges obtained, expressed as μg ml−1, were: 5–10 for Saccharomyces cerevisiaeNCPF 3139; 10–20 for S. cerevisiaeNCPF 3178; 20–40 for Escherichia coliNCTC 10418; 40–80 for E. coliNCTC 11560, Candida albicansATCC 10231 and C. tropicalisNCPF; and 80–160 for C. albicansNCPF 3242 and NCPF 3262.
